Output 84aaada35de40695fd4bf8f90f61062be6de49b49bf2f0ae3b53c41b25e9fde7:0

value
275127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dedcb7bb115b973ecd5e32556e618fcb361ef152 OP_EQUAL
address
3N1QLs6sKbRZaXpg62MRGTyYYo7hm3s3Vi
transaction
84aaada35de40695fd4bf8f90f61062be6de49b49bf2f0ae3b53c41b25e9fde7
confirmations
299399
spent
true